Where are Toyota Tundras made?

Production began in May 1999 at Toyota Motor Manufacturing, Indiana (TMMI), before moving to the Toyota Motor Manufacturing, Texas (TMMTX) plant in San Antonio in 2008. It's still assembled there today and remains the only full-size pickup truck made in Texas.

Is the Tundra the most American made truck?

Because 65% of the Tundra's parts originate in the U.S. or Canada and it's assembled in San Antonio Texas, Cars.com named it the most “American-made” full-size pickup truck. But some economists argue that because Toyota's headquartered abroad, the Tundra comes in second place–just behind the Ford F-150.

Who makes Toyota Tundra engines?

— Toyota Alabama will be the sole North American producer of a new twin-turbo V6 engine for the 2022 Toyota Tundra. According to Toyota Alabama, the new engine production added 450 jobs, bringing the plant's total employment to 1,800.

Is Tundra better than Ford?

In terms of truck capabilities, Ford is the clear winner. Our Tundra, as equipped, had a maximum payload of 1,740 pounds and a towing capacity of 11,120 pounds. The Ford, meanwhile, offered a 2,100-pound payload capacity and, with its Max Trailering package, a towing capacity of 13,900 pounds.

Does Tundra hold value?

As for how much the Toyota Tundra depreciates every year? CarEdge reports you can the Tundra will depreciate approximately 15% after one year of ownership. After two years, the Tundra will have retained 81.62% of its value.

Where are Toyota Tacomas built?

The Tacoma is assembled at Toyota Motor Manufacturing, Texas (TMMTX), in San Antonio, Tex. and Toyota Motor Manufacturing, Baja California (TMMBC), in Baja California, Mexico.

Is RAM made in America?

Production. Ram vehicles are manufactured at four facilities, two in North America, one in Western Asia, and one in South America. Warren Truck Assembly, Warren, Michigan, United States. First opened in 1938, the facility has produced trucks for Dodge and Ram for over 70 years.
